I have e90 335xi sport package I think the suspension is the same though on the XI's any way....I am running

19" x 8.5" front with hankook v12 235/35/19
19" x 10" rear with hankook v12 275/30/19

No problems at all.... It looks like I could even lower it a little and it would be fine....
